How to Start a Sportsbook


A sportsbook is a type of gambling establishment that accepts bets on sporting events. Its customers can place their bets on various sports, such as football, basketball, baseball, hockey, and others. The sportsbook also offers bettors the chance to make future bets on their favorite teams and players. Generally, bettors can place wagers on the total score of an event or on a team’s winning margin. However, bettors can also place props or proposition bets, which are nothing but wagers on individual players or specific aspects of a game.

A good sportsbook will offer odds and spreads that are competitive with those of the rest of the market. It will also offer expert analysis and picks from seasoned sports bettors. This will help attract punters to the site and keep them coming back.

In the United States, legal sportsbooks can be found online or in casinos and racetracks. They are also available on casino cruise ships and in some states at private bookmakers that are often referred to as “bookies”. The bookies take bets over the phone, via online systems, or in person. They also accept bets on non-sports events, such as politics, fantasy sports, and esports.

Many people don’t realize it, but there is a lot of money to be made by running a sportsbook. The competition is stiff, and you need to do everything you can to attract customers. This includes having a great website, excellent customer support, and offering competitive odds and spreads.

A reputable sportsbook will use a random number generator to verify the accuracy of bets. This will ensure that the bets are fair and that no one has an advantage over another. It will also ensure that all winning bets are paid out in a timely manner.

In addition to random number generation, a sportsbook should have several other security features. These include a secure socket layer (SSL) certificate and a strong password policy. This will protect bettors’ information from hackers and other malicious activities. A sportsbook should also have a user-friendly registration process and be easy to use.

When starting a sportsbook, it’s important to remember that gambling is a highly regulated industry. Depending on where you live, you may need to comply with local laws and regulations regarding responsible gambling. This means implementing features such as betting limits, time counters, warnings, daily limits, and more. It’s best to consult with a lawyer to ensure that your sportsbook is compliant.

Unlike traditional turnkey and white-label solutions, pay per head sportsbook software lets you pay only for the players you actually engage with. This gives you the flexibility to scale during peak seasons without paying out more than you’re taking in. In contrast, a standard subscription-based solution will require you to shell out a big sum of money for the same amount of players during off-seasons, when you’re barely making any profit at all.

Another drawback of white-label and turnkey sportsbook software is that it can be difficult to decouple from a particular provider. This can be frustrating for some users, especially when it comes to a new release or feature update.